The learned counsel for the respondent No.1 has placed on record the order dated 28th February 2019, vide which the chargesheet issued against the petitioner has been withdrawn.
In that view of the matter, the purpose of the petition stands served. The petition is, therefore, disposed of.
However, taking into consideration the fact that the petitioner has already retired from services, it is directed that all terminal benefits, to which the petitioner is entitled to, be paid to him within a period of three months from today.
